前端Web3区块链,当网页不再只是窗口,而是通往新世界的入口

投稿 2026-02-12 18:18 点击数: 1

从“打开网页”到“进入世界”:前端正在经历一场范式革命

如果你是10年前的前端开发者,你的工作可能是用HTML、CSS和JavaScript构建一个静态网页,让用户能“看到”信息;如果你是5年前的前端开发者,你可能更关注如何用React、Vue等框架优化用户体验,让网页“更好用”,但今天,当“Web3”“区块链”这些词频繁出现在技术讨论中时,前端正在迎来一场更深刻的变革——它不再仅仅是连接用户与服务的“窗口”,而是可能成为用户进入去中心化数字世界的“入口”。

要理解这场变革,我们得先拆解三个关键词:前端Web3区块链,它们不是孤立的概念,而是层层递进的技术逻辑:区块链是底层基础设施,Web3是基于区块链的下一代互联网形态,而前端则是用户与这一切交互的“最后一公里”。

区块链:给互联网装上“信任的引擎”

先说区块链,它是一种“去中心化的分布式账本技术”,你可以把它想象成一本“全网公开、不可篡改的账本”——传统账本由银行或平台中心化保存(比如你的微信余额由腾讯服务器记录),而区块链的账本则由网络中的所有参与者共同维护,任何一笔交易(比如转账、记录信息)都需要经过多数节点验证,一旦写入就几乎无法修改。

这种技术的核心价值是“信任机器”:它不需要依赖第三方中介,就能让陌生人之间建立信任,传统转账需要银行作为中介,确认双方账户和交易;而在区块链上,通过密码学和共识机制,交易双方可以直接点对点完成,全网共同见证结果。

区块链的关键特性包括:

  • 去中心化:没有单一机构控制,权力属于网络参与者;
  • 透明性:所有公开数据可被实时查询,但身份通过加密保护;
  • 不可篡改:历史数据一旦上链,几乎不可能被删除或修改;
  • 可编程性:通过“智能合约”(自动执行的代码规则),实现复杂逻辑的自动化处理。

从比特币(区块链1.0,实现数字货币)到以太坊(区块链2.0,支持智能合约),再到如今的Layer2扩容、跨链技术,区块链正在从“数字货币的底层”逐步扩展到“信任基础设施”,为Web3提供技术支撑。

Web3:从“读”互联网到“拥有”互联网

再聊Web3,我们常说的Web1.0是“静态互联网”(1990-2005年),用户只能“读”信息,比如门户网站;Web2.0是“互动互联网”(2005年至今),用户可以“写”和“分享”,比如社交媒体、电商平台,但数据所有权掌握在平台手中(比如你的朋友圈数据属于腾讯,你的购物记录属于淘宝)。

Web3,则是“价值互联网”或“去中心化互联网”(约2020年起),核心目标是“用户数据所有权”“价值互联网”,在Web3世界里:

  • 用户不再依赖平台,而是通过“去中心化身份”(DID)自主控制数据;
  • 数据和资产以“通证”(Token)的形式确权,用户真正“拥有”自己的数字身份、社交关系、创作内容;
  • 价值可以直接在用户之间传递,无需平台抽成,比如创作者的作品可以直接通过NFT(非同质化通证)卖给粉丝,收益归自己所有。

举个例子:在Web2的抖音上,你创作的内容属于字节跳动,流量和收益由平台分配;在Web3的去中心化社交应用(如Lens Protocol)上,你的身份、内容、粉丝关系都记录在区块链上,你可以带着这些资产“自由迁徙”到其他平台,收益也直接进入你的加密钱包。

前端:Web3世界的“翻译官”与“建筑师”

最后到前端,在Web2时代,前端的核心是“将后端数据渲染成用户友好的界面”;但在Web3时代,前端的角色发生了质变——它不仅要连接用户与区块链,更要“翻译”复杂的技术逻辑,让普通人也能轻松使用去中心化应用(DApps)。

前端需要“适配”区块链的新特性

与传统Web应用不同,DApps的交互对象是区块链,而不是中心化服务器,这意味着前端必须处理一系列新问题:

  • 钱包连接:用户需要通过加密钱包(如MetaMask、Phantom)与区块链交互,前端必须实现钱包连接、签名授权等功能;
  • 链上数据读取:区块链数据不是从API直接获取,而是通过节点(如Infura、Alchemy)或去中心化节点网络(如The Graph)查询,前端需要封装这些复杂的链上交互逻辑;
  • 交易状态管理:一笔链上交易可能需要几秒到几分钟才能确认(比如以太坊主网),前端需要实时反馈交易状态(“待签名”“已上链”“失败”),避免用户困惑;
  • 多链适配:区块链生态有以太坊、Solana、Polygon等多条公链,前端需要支持跨链资产和应用的切换。

前端技术栈的“Web3化”

为了应对这些需求,前端技术栈也在快速迭代:

  • 钱包集成库:如wagmi(React)、viem(底层工具库),简化钱包连接和交易签名;
  • UI组件库:如RainbowKit、Web3Modal,提供标准化的Web3交互组件(比如连接钱包的按钮、资产展示卡片);
  • 状态管理:除了Redux、Zustand,还需要管理钱包状态、链上数据状态、交易状态等复杂逻辑;
  • 去中心化存储:前端可以直接与IPFS(星际文件系统)、Arweave等存储协议交互,实现去中心化的资源加载(比如NFT的图片、视频)。

用户体验的“破局点”

Web3应用一直被诟病“用户体验差”(比如钱包创建复杂、交易等待时间长、 gas费(链上交易手续费)不透明),而前端正是改善体验的关键:

  • 抽象复杂度:用“一键登录”替代“12个助记词抄写”,用“余额估算”让用户提前了解gas费;
  • 可视化交互:将链上数据(如交易历史、资产持仓)用图表、卡片等直观方式呈现;
  • 跨平台支持:通过PWA(渐进式Web应用)、TWA(Trusted Web Activity)等技术,让DApps像原生App一样在手机端使用,降低用户使用门槛。

现实中的Web3前端:不止于“炒币”

提到Web3,很多人第一反应是“炒币”,但Web3前端的远不止于此,它正在构建一个更广阔的数字世界:

  • 去中心化金融(DeFi):前端连接用户与借贷、交易协议,让普通人能通过网页进行理财、交易(比如Uniswap的DEX交易界面);
  • 数字藏品(NFT):前端展示NFT的图片、属性,支持购买、转让,甚至构建“虚拟展厅”(比如OpenSea的藏品页面);
  • 去中心化社交(DeSocial):前端实现动态发布、关注、点赞等社交功能,但数据存储在链上,用户真正拥有自己的社交关系;
  • GameFi:前端构建游戏界面,玩家可以通过钱包登录,游戏道具、资产以NFT形式存在,可跨游戏使用。

挑战与未来:前端开发者的“新必修课”

尽管前景广阔,Web3前端仍面临不少挑战:

  • 性能瓶颈:区块链确认速度慢、节点延迟高,如何优化前端交互体验是难题;
  • 安全风险:钱包私钥管理、智能合约漏洞等安全问题,需要前端与后端协同防护;
  • 技术碎片化:不同公链、钱包、协议的接口差异大,前端需要适配更多复杂场景;
  • 用户教育成本:Web3概念对普通人仍较陌生,前端需要通过引导、提示降低认知门槛。

但对前端开发者而言,这更是一次机遇:掌握W

随机配图
eb3技术栈,意味着从“互联网的界面开发者”升级为“数字世界的架构师”,随着区块链性能提升(如以太坊2.0、Layer2扩容)、用户教育普及,Web3前端可能会像今天的React、Vue一样,成为开发者的“新必修课”。

当网页成为“入口”,前端定义新世界

从Web1.0的静态页面,到Web2.0的互动应用,再到Web3的去中心化世界,前端的边界正在不断扩展,它不再仅仅是“写代码、做界面”,而是要理解区块链的信任逻辑,构建用户与去中心化世界的桥梁。

或许未来的某一天,你打开的不再是一个简单的网页,而是一个可以自主控制数据、自由传递价值、真正属于你的数字空间,而这一切,都从今天前端开发者对“Web3区块链